TJ JOLLY, U15-U19 PREMIER DIRECTOR
TJ Jolly grew up in Jamestown, New York where she represented Jamestown High School, leading them to a State Semi-Final appearance as a goalkeeper. Her contributions would land her a collegiate offer at Allegheny College, earning Jolly a spot on the Collegiate All-American Team where she would decide upon pursuing a passion for sport and academia while acquiring her MSc in Sport and Exercise Science from the University of Northern Colorado.
Jolly began her coaching career at Jamestown Area Youth Soccer before coaching at George Washington High School, Denver North High School, Eagle Ridge High School, Millsaps College, Albion College, and Boulder County United, during which she was awarded her USC National Coaching Diploma, USC Advanced National Goalkeeping Diploma, and USSF D License. She has furthered her educational and professional development through earning her Positive Coaching Alliance: Coaching for Peak Performance, Positive Coaching Alliance: Positive Coaching for High School Athletes, NCAA Women’s Coaching Academy Graduate, Functional Movement Systems Level 2 Certification, BOSU Complete Workout System Certification, and the Super Series Group Strength Training Certification to empower athletes to be the best versions of themselves and helping her clubs with administration, fundraising, and community impact.
TJ Jolly looks to promote to her the lessons that soccer can teach her athletes that can be applied to our everyday lives at home, school, work, and our community at large. A dedicated runner, she is also working towards completing a half (or full) marathon in all 50 states plus Washington D.C to prove how strong dedication can be.
